Earlier today, we learned that Reco Love and Photo Kano developer Dingo declared bankruptcy, ceasing all development activities. Kadokawa Games Producer Ichiro Sugiyama followed up on Reco Love's official Twitter account to reassure the fans on the future of the series.

Sugiyama-san mentions that he's really sorry to hear about the demise of Dingo, but all rights for Photo Kano and Reco Love remain with Kadokawa Games, so the fans don't need to worry about the future, and should look forward to what's coming.

With the DLC of Reco Love settled, Sugiyama-san is starting to write a new scenario. While he's in contact with the main staff of the game, he intends to utilize the experience of Photo Kano and Reco Love and work hard to satisfy everyone.

Photo Kano was released in Japan for PSP in February 2nd, 2012, with a PS Vita version following a year later. Reco Love launched on PS Vita on October 20th, 2016. Neither game has been released in the west, but they're widely considered spiritual successors of the popular dating sims KimiKiss and Amagami.
